General Specs
Devices
Chipset:
| Component | Name | HardwareID | Status | Driver |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Processor | Intel(R) | ACPI. ACPI showing 4 cores. | ||
| HDD | Advanced Host Controller Interface | OS2AHCI | ||
| Audio | Not Tested | |||
| Video | Panorama | |||
| Network | Not Tested | |||
| Wireless Network | Not Tested | |||
| Wireless Bluetooth | Not Supported | |||
| USB 2.0 | Working USB (mouse and thumb drive tested as well as USB keyboard in docking station) after disabling USB3.0 in BIOS. | |||
| WebCam | Not Tested | |||
| CardBus | Not Tested | |||
| UEFI boot | Not Supported | |||
| SD/MMC slot | Not Tested |
Comments
Installation on X250 from USB-CD/DVD-ROM failed. eCS v2.1 startet up to maintenance screen bot no HDD was found. eCS v2.2 BetaII even did not start up from CD/DVD-ROM. I tried to clone my existing system using DFSee and finally worked after some trouble with partition alignment. Status now on X250 is a working eCS v.2.1 with ACPI showing 4 cores, full support of native screen resolution via PANORAMA, working USB (mouse and thumb drive tested as well as USB keyboard in docking station) after disabling USB3.0 in BIOS.
